What is an example of negative feeback of the homeostatic regulation?
Negative feedback happens when the response to a given action makes an effect that inhibits that action. For example, when the carbon dioxide concentration in blood is high the pulmonary respiration is stimulated for the CO2 excess to be expelled by expiration. Hyperventilation, however, lowers the carbon dioxide concentration in blood too much generating a negative feedback that commands the decrease of the respiratory frequency.
Negative feedback is the major mechanism of homeostasis and it happens in a variety of processes, as in blood pressure control, glycemic control, muscle contraction, etc.
